請問大家,我們有許多不同群組,想用API依照狀況發訊息到不同群組去,Message API可以做到嗎?如果可以 大致方法是甚麼 謝謝大家
以Python的話....
取得USER ID或GROUP ID的code
@handler.add(MessageEvent, message=TextMessage)
def handle_message(event):
if event.message.text == 'ID?' or event.message.text == 'id?':
User_ID = TextMessage(text=event.source.user_id)
line_bot_api.reply_message(event.reply_token, User_ID)
print ('Reply User ID =>' + event.source.user_id)
elif event.message.text == 'GroupID?':
Group_ID = TextMessage(text=event.source.group_id)
line_bot_api.reply_message(event.reply_token, Group_ID)
print ('Reply Group ID =>' + event.source.group_id)
else:
None
推送訊息的部份
line_bot_api.push_message("USER ID or GROUP ID",TextSendMessage(text=""))